A question because I'm only 10 days into owning this car and I'm not sure if it's me or the car right now:

The gearbox is definitely notchy in 2nd and 3rd gear, probably 3/4 of the time when shifting. 1, 4, 5 and 6 are not - it's only 2 and 3. I don't even hear a sound, it's purely in the feel of the shift. Goes into gear fine, just feels a little more forced/notchy than the other gears.

Is this something I should ask the dealer about, like a symptom of the transmission problems, or is this me being absolutely amateur at shifting this thing? Thanks in advance.

I still haven't made a thread (which I need to), but thought I'd add some relevent info:

I took my car in for a whine in all gears, it was fairly loud and had started with delivery of the car (at first just thought it was normal noise until it kept getting louder, my car came with 108 miles from the factory, it was pulled for longer term testing before delivery to dealer and had a note in the window of such).

Today during check in with the dealer, they mentioned that the whine would have turned into something much worse very shortly had I not brought it in, and that a replacement transmission had been authorized and the original plan to replace parts in mine had been scrapped. There's a backorder of the MT82's, and I have a priority request for one, but its pretty interesting stuff.

Other than an occassional difficult shift into 4th when the transmission was hot, I really didn't have any problems with mine outside the whine. I was surprised to find that the whole thing is being replaced at 20k on my car, however happy that Ford is taking my satisfaction so seriously.
